My brother's and I headed up to Penn's Creek yesterday. We arrived at the stream around 10:00am and headed to the middle of the Catch and Release section. The chilly air and light rain created one heck of an atmosphere for bugs to hatch. Grannom's, Quill Gordon's, Hendrickson's, BWO's and Blue Quills hatched in tremendous numbers till 5pm. The stream was not boiling with risers but there were plenty to give us one of the best day's of dry-fly fishing in years on this stream. Posted the pictures on the blog.
